To find your VAT number, you can check your VAT registration certificate, which HMRC provides once you complete the registration process. You can also call the HMRC VAT helpline on 0300 200 3700.
The VAT Directive: establishes the framework within which VAT is applied to transactions in various economic activities, encompassing the supply of goods and services, intra-Community acquisitions, imports, and other relevant transactions.
VAT (Value Added Tax) is a tax added to most products and services sold by VAT -registered businesses.
America does not have a VAT system, and the US does not issue a number. Note, however, that sales tax does apply to the sale of goods and services in the US. Read our guide on the difference between VAT vs sales tax to learn more.
While the EIN is indispensable for U.S. businesses in managing employee-related taxes and federal compliance, the VAT number facilitates the collection and remittance of Value Added Tax on goods and services in VAT-implementing countries, marking the fundamental distinction in their roles across different tax systems.
The U.S. does not have a VAT system, but when required companies may register and report VAT in the EU, UK, Australia and parts of Asia. VAT numbers are approved by tax authorities when your company has business activities in their country that legally require VAT reporting. Do you need a VAT number?
America does not have a VAT system, and the US does not issue a number. Note, however, that sales tax does apply to the sale of goods and services in the US. Read our guide on the difference between VAT vs sales tax to learn more.
Standard VAT: It applies to most goods and services at a uniform rate, which makes the administration process simpler. Differential VAT: It uses different rates for domestic and imported goods and services. Small Business VAT: It uses simplified VAT systems that have lower reporting requirements for smaller businesses.

VAT-203 is a tax return form used for filing Value Added Tax (VAT) in certain jurisdictions.
Businesses and individuals who are registered for VAT and have taxable transactions are required to file VAT-203.
To fill out VAT-203, taxpayers must provide information about their sales, purchases, and VAT collected and paid, following the guidelines provided by the tax authority.
The purpose of VAT-203 is to report VAT liabilities and payments to the tax authority, ensuring compliance with tax regulations.
VAT-203 must report information including total sales, total purchases, VAT collected from customers, and VAT paid on purchases.
